Stefan Pintilie 32e1c9e8c8 [PowerPC][Future] Initial support for PCRel addressing for constant pool loads
Add initial support for PC Relative addressing for constant pool loads.
This includes adding a new relocation for @pcrel and adding a new PowerPC flag
to identify PC relative addressing.
